

Sangfor HCI and Azure Local compete in the hyper-converged infrastructure category. Sangfor appears to have the upper hand in pricing and user support, while Azure Local is favored for its robust features and seamless integration with Microsoft environments.
Features: Sangfor HCI is noted for its manageability, user-friendly interface, auto-scaling capabilities, built-in firewall, and robust security measures. It supports easy scalability and integrated management. Azure Local is preferred for performance, Kubernetes integration with AKS, and its compatibility with Microsoft systems, which enables efficient Azure storage utilization.
Room for Improvement:Sangfor HCI requires enhancements in SAS configurations, better compatibility with third-party tools, security improvements, more documentation, and community support. Improvements in cloud service support and pricing structures are also needed. Azure Local could refine its software-defined networking, better its integration with Azure tools, improve multi-cluster management, and make licensing more accessible while addressing stretched cluster functionality.
Ease of Deployment and Customer Service: Sangfor HCI accommodates various deployment modes with a strong regional support network, though language barriers are occasionally reported. Azure Local offers hybrid deployment options, supporting diverse environments, but deployment can be complex, especially in networking, requiring a skilled support team.
Pricing and ROI: Sangfor HCI is seen as cost-effective, offering a competitive single license that incorporates features leading to lower operational costs and favorable ROI. Azure Local is more expensive due to its licensing structure but aligns well with Microsoft environments, potentially providing substantial ROI through seamless integration despite higher initial and ongoing costs.

Azure Local integrates on-premises infrastructure with cloud services, offering tools for software-defined networking, Kubernetes deployment, and VM management. It ensures cost efficiency through existing Microsoft licenses and robust disaster recovery, despite some complexities in deployment.
Azure Local is designed for businesses needing a blend of local and cloud services while remaining compliant with data privacy regulations. It excels in environments demanding high computing power, software-defined networking, and seamless scaling through Azure Kubernetes Service and Azure DevOps. Although it offers excellent VM management and analytics capabilities with Microsoft Fabric, deployment complexity and operational challenges remain. Businesses looking for a robust edge computing solution find significant benefits, especially with efficient local Azure storage and advanced hardware such as the latest processors and SSDs. There are areas needing improvements like multi-cluster management, stability, and Initial setup, which can be cumbersome. Pricing can be a concern against competitors, and enhanced support and training are needed for smoother user experience.

Sangfor HCI offers an efficient, user-friendly hyper-converged infrastructure solution with strong integration capabilities. It provides robust scalability, data recovery, and easy cloud support with competitive pricing.
Sangfor HCI delivers a hyper-converged infrastructure that integrates computing, storage, and networking into a single system. It features a user-friendly interface and seamless integration. The solution offers robust scalability, data recovery capabilities, and built-in backup. Organizations appreciate its single management console and high security through native firewalls. Migration from other platforms is simplified, and native cloud support broadens its appeal. Sangfor HCI allows infrastructure design with topology and comprehensive technical support. However, improvements are needed in command line availability, documentation, security features, performance, and cloud integration.
